Along the beautiful Flat Rock River, near Waldron, Indiana, live two 7th generation farm girls, Ava and Bremley Doig. They are also 4th generation cattlewomen. Their great grandparents, Garnett and Gene Jones, received two horned Hereford cows for a wedding present 70 years ago, and introduced these docile, adaptable cattle to River Bend’s rolling pastures.

The girl’s grandmother, Leslie Doig, began showing cattle 50 years ago. Their father, Bill G., has served as a Junior Director for the National Hereford Youth, and has showed on the national and international level for 25 years. Ava and Bremley’s grandfather, “Doc”, has a veterinary practice in Waldron. He loves to travel to the shows and can usually be found helping in the wash rack or leading one into the show ring. Their mother, Joni, a graduate of the Ohio State University, grew up near Rushville, Indiana. Coincidentally, the Flat Rock River flows near her home farm as well. She is an avid cattlewoman and has taken on the marketing and advertising duties at River Bend.

Leslie keeps the farm running by keeping everyone organized, the stalls cleaned and being “Grandma” to Ava and her little sister, Bremley. She and the girls spend quality time roaming the pastures and checking cows together.

An Animal Science major and member of the Purdue University livestock judging team, Bill got his MS in Ruminant Nutrition at the University of Kentucky. While there, he coached the UK livestock judging team. He judges across the United States and in Canada. Bill has served as a director for the Indiana Hereford Association. Bill stays busy during the summer judging several open and 4-H shows.

It is the mission of all of us at River Bend Farms to have a family operation that provides life experiences and quality time, while promoting high quality Hereford cattle. We want to share and teach others about livestock, and have hosted local 4-Hers for fitting, showmanship, and nutrition clinics.
